Captain America #9

May 2012 · Marvel · 3.99 USD
“Powerless Part 4”

In "Powerless Part 4," Captain America faces the vulnerability of his weakened body while Sharon struggles to stay ahead of Machinesmith’s relentless pursuit. Meanwhile, Falcon tracks down Bravo and his Hydra operatives, pushing the stakes higher in a tense, high-stakes struggle. Written by Ed Brubaker and brought to life by Alan Davis’s dynamic art, with inks by Mark Farmer and colors by Laura Martin, this issue captures the raw intensity of a hero pushed to his limits. The cover, also by Alan Davis with inks by Mark Farmer, perfectly frames the moment’s urgency.
